Output 84e5ec3754810336cbde3937de446abc8e6ffcad0601f1245bcbae84adfd04ae:7

value
165655
script pubkey
OP_0 OP_PUSHBYTES_20 31a3790cce21e1f680d61c00223ab520029f183f
address
bc1qxx3hjrxwy8sldqxkrsqzyw44yqpf7xplqz0xvh
transaction
84e5ec3754810336cbde3937de446abc8e6ffcad0601f1245bcbae84adfd04ae